element-x-ada/tests
Jorge Martin Espinosa 410a3d132b
Add floating/sticky date badge in the timeline (#6496)
* Add floating date indicator while scrolling the timeline (#6433)

* Add `FeatureFlags.FloatingDateBadge`. This enables displaying the floating date badge in the timeline as you scroll.

* Don't display the floating badge if the timeline isn't reversed. Otherwise, this will affect talkback users and break the existing navigation

* Use `TimelineItem.formattedDate()` to get the date to display. Always try finding the closest one (usually it will be just the 1st one we try).

* Align designs with iOS. Also fix shadows in fade animation by adding some paddings.

* Update screenshots

---------

Co-authored-by: Gianluca Iavicoli <gianluca.iavicoli04@gmail.com>
Co-authored-by: ElementBot <android@element.io>
2026-04-01 10:45:57 +00:00
..
detekt-rules Copyright: Add Element Creations Ltd. copyright 2025-11-10 11:05:05 +01:00
konsist Improve preview by adding a background color. 2026-03-11 15:43:15 +01:00
testutils Cleanup 2026-01-02 16:07:45 +01:00
uitests Add floating/sticky date badge in the timeline (#6496) 2026-04-01 10:45:57 +00:00